Comment puis-je démarrer et arrêter les services sur une machine distante?
J'ai une exigence dans le projet tel que nous devons nous arrêter un service spécifique dire "x" dans une machine distante (qui est sur le même réseau local), changer la clé de registre à distance et redémarrez le service.
J'ai essayé la commande sc \server stop service
, mais j'ai l'erreur:
[SC] GetServiceKeyName ÉCHOUÉ 1060:
Le service spécifié n'existe pas en tant que service installé.
Je suis avec Windows 2003 SP1. Y a-construit dans les commandes ou les Api qui sont disponibles sur Windows?
J'ai besoin de la commande à exécuter sur l'invite de commande.
OriginalL'auteur | 2009-02-17
Vous devez vous connecter pour publier un commentaire.
Aussi garder à l'esprit que le "nom du service" argument attendu par le "sc" outil de ligne de commande n'est pas toujours égale au nom de vous voir dans le panneau de configuration des services de l'applet (qui est le service "nom d'affichage").
Par exemple, le service qui apparaît comme "Adobe Acrobat Service de mise à Jour" dans mon panneau de configuration des services applet a une nom réel de "AdobeARMservice". Vous devez utiliser ce dernier, mais pas le premier, lorsque la gestion du service par le biais de la "sc" utilitaire.
Exemple:
Pour obtenir le "vrai" nom d'un service, double-cliquez sur son entrée dans le service applet du panneau de configuration et voir le "nom du service" champ de l'onglet Général.
Bien sûr, dans certains cas, le nom complet et le nom du service sont les mêmes.
OriginalL'auteur Mark R.
Vous voudrez peut-être chercher dans PSTools de SysInternals. Ces outils sont disponibles gratuitement et peuvent vous aider à gérer les processus sur un ordinateur Windows distant.
Les outils inclus dans le PsTools suite, qui sont téléchargeables sous forme de paquet, sont:
OriginalL'auteur David S.
De cette URL:
Peut-être qu'il vous manque un caractère"\"?
OriginalL'auteur gahooa
Utilisation OpenCSManager, puis OpenService, puis StartService.
OriginalL'auteur sharptooth